Midlands-born Jatinder Sharma is Principal and Chief Executive of Walsall College, having previously held a number of senior positions in both private and public sectors.
Walsall College employs over 850 people, delivering technical and vocational qualifications, apprenticeships and higher education to a community of more than 11,000 students. Training is delivered from campuses across Walsall as well as locations in Cannock and King’s Norton, Birmingham, in addition to online learning and on-the-job training with employers.
Jatinder is a passionate champion of the vital role that skills and training play in the development of the West Midlands economy and the ongoing regeneration of Walsall and the Black Country.
The College works closely with more than 1,000 employers, the Black Country LEP and West Midlands Combined Authority, to ensure that its students develop the qualifications, attributes, work experience and work-related skills to match the region’s growing employment sectors now and in the future.
Jatinder was awarded a CBE in 2023 New Year Honours for his services to Further Education. He is a board member of the Association of Colleges, Black Country Chamber of Commerce, and a member of the Walsall Proud Partnership. He also represents further education on the Department for Education Principals’ Reference Group.
